Background of Motus GI Holdings, Inc. (MOTS)

Motus GI Holdings, Inc. is a medical technology company focused on developing innovative medical devices for gastrointestinal endoscopy procedures. The company was founded with the mission of improving clinical outcomes and enhancing the user experience for physicians and patients during diagnostic and therapeutic procedures.

The company's primary product is the Pure-Vu® System, a medical device designed to improve bowel preparation and visualization during colonoscopy procedures. This technology addresses a significant challenge in colorectal screening and diagnostic procedures, where inadequate bowel preparation can lead to incomplete examinations and potential missed diagnoses.

Motus GI went public in 2017, trading on the NASDAQ under the ticker symbol MOTS. The company has been primarily focused on developing and commercializing medical technologies that can potentially improve patient care and clinical workflow in gastroenterology.

Key areas of focus for Motus GI include:

  • Developing advanced endoscopy solutions
  • Improving diagnostic capabilities in gastrointestinal procedures
  • Enhancing patient and physician experience during medical examinations

The company has invested significantly in research and development to advance its medical device technologies, with a particular emphasis on the Pure-Vu® System and its potential applications in various medical settings.
